Scout report
R. Owusu-Oduro is a 22-year-old goalkeeper at AZ Alkmaar, rated 70.9 overall by Field Insider's model, ranking 58th of 284 on scout potential in the Eredivisie and 327th of 2874 U-23 players tracked. An emerging talent, he has been a regular starter this season (73.5% of available minutes). Below: strengths, watch-points, market-value outlook and the latest transfer news on Owusu-Oduro.
Judged on this season alone, Owusu-Oduro graded 19 — a solid campaign that ranks top 37% of the 22 goalkeepers in the Eredivisie, on 6 clean sheets across 23 appearances.
Year-on-year, that's a drop on last season (Season 34 → 19). Over the 4 seasons on record his form has trended upward, peaking in 2024/25.
On long-term talent our Rating reads 71, top 14% of the 22 goalkeepers in the Eredivisie. At 22 Owusu-Oduro is still climbing toward his ceiling, and a market index of 31 reflects that trajectory.
Read the appearance count in context: Owusu-Oduro missed 3 games through injury (injury, inactive) out of roughly 34 this season. The 23 he did play is a solid return on the time he was fit, and his ratings are weighted toward those games rather than the ones he sat out injured.
Below his 2024/25 peak but holding a solid level — the platform for a return is there.
Output in context · AZ Alkmaar finished 7th of 18 · a mid-table side
6 clean sheets in 23 appearances (26% of games).
